  2. Begin with Section A: Enter the receiving fund’s details, including the Australian business number (ABN), name, and postal address. Ensure you provide at least one of the required fund numbers.
  3. Move to Section B: Fill in the member’s details. Include their tax file number (TFN), title, full name, postal address, date of birth, sex, daytime phone number, and email address if applicable.
  4. In Section C: Rollover payment details, specify the service period start date and detail the rollover components. Clearly indicate amounts for tax-free and taxable components.
  5. Complete Section D: Your details by providing your fund’s ABN, name, contact information, and signature of an authorized person along with the date.
